Output f6b4d54a4ddf0eb12ade11b36363c3e914ad97940a6644f1fbdfabb4480bd26f:1

value
17914742
script pubkey
OP_0 OP_PUSHBYTES_20 a1cbd4caa9c1356888f973aacccfce150feeeae2
address
bc1q589afj4fcy6k3z8eww4ven7wz587a6hzmxv7v8
transaction
f6b4d54a4ddf0eb12ade11b36363c3e914ad97940a6644f1fbdfabb4480bd26f
confirmations
74649
spent
true